Как в Битрикс определить пользователя загрузившего картинку?

В Bitrix есть несколько способов определить пользователя, загрузившего картинку. Вот некоторые из них: 1. Через объект CFile: - Получите ID загруженной картинки. - Используйте метод GetFileArray() класса CFile для получения информации о файле, включая ID пользователя - $fileArray['CREATED_BY']. - Используйте ID пользователя для получения остальной информации о нем. 2. Через событие в момент загрузки файла: ... Читать далее

Битрикс — почему не применяется купон к заказу?

Существует несколько возможных причин, по которым купон не применяется к заказу в 1С-Битрикс. Вот несколько наиболее распространенных проблем и их решение: 1. Проблемы с настройками купона: Первым делом, убедитесь, что купон настроен правильно. Проверьте условия применения купона и убедитесь, что они выполняются для данного заказа. Может быть, вы не правильно указали условия использования купона, или ... Читать далее

Как вывести дату активности у новости?

Для вывода даты активности новости в CMS 1C-Bitrix вам необходимо использовать соответствующий компонент новостей и модифицировать его шаблон. 1. Сначала необходимо открыть файл компонента bitrix/news.list/component.php, который располагается в папке с шаблонами вашей темы Bitrix. 2. В этом файле вы найдете цикл, который выводит каждую новость: foreach ($arResult['ITEMS'] as $arItem) { // Вывод заголовка новости echo ... Читать далее

Как вывести наименование свойства справочник в корзине?

Чтобы вывести наименование свойства справочника в корзине сайта, необходимо выполнить следующие шаги: 1. Открыть файл шаблона корзины (обычно это файл bitrix/components/bitrix/sale.basket.basket/bitrix/sale.basket.basket/template.php) в редакторе кода. 2. Найти код, отвечающий за вывод информации о товарах в корзине. Обычно это цикл, который проходит по всем товарам в корзине. Внутри цикла найдите строку, которая выводит наименование товара (обычно она ... Читать далее

Как начать работать с битрикс в докере?

Для начала работы с 1C-Bitrix в Docker, вам необходимо выполнить несколько шагов. 1. Установите Docker. Перейдите на официальный сайт Docker (https://www.docker.com/) и скачайте соответствующую версию Docker для вашей операционной системы. Установите Docker, следуя инструкциям, предоставленным на сайте. 2. Скачайте образ Docker. 1C-Bitrix предоставляет официальный образ Docker, который содержит все необходимые компоненты, чтобы запустить сайт на ... Читать далее

Как вернуть поехавшую верстку футера в 1с битрикс после неудачной попытки внедрения компанента?

Если после попытки внедрения компонента верстка футера поехала, то есть несколько способов вернуть ее в исходное состояние в 1C-Bitrix: 1. Откатить изменения: - Если вы используете систему контроля версий (например, Git), переключитесь на предыдущую версию проекта, содержащую рабочую версию футера. Это позволит вам вернуться к стабильной версии футера и отменить внесенные изменения. - Если нет ... Читать далее

Как ограничить количество заполнений веб-формы?

Веб-формы в 1C-Bitrix предоставляют удобный способ собирать и обрабатывать информацию от пользователей. Если вы хотите ограничить количество заполнений веб-формы, чтобы, например, каждый пользователь мог отправить форму только определенное количество раз, то вам понадобится добавить дополнительную логику в код вашего сайта. Вот несколько способов, которые вы можете использовать для ограничения количества заполнений веб-формы на основе 1C-Bitrix: ... Читать далее

Как настроить логирование на сайте битрикс?

Настройка логирования на сайте Битрикс включает несколько шагов: 1. Откройте административную панель сайта Битрикс. 2. Перейдите в раздел "Настройки" -> "Настройки продукта" -> "Настройки системы". 3. В разделе "Настройки системы" найдите вкладку "Логирование" и нажмите на нее. 4. В разделе "Логирование" вы найдете несколько параметров, которые можно настроить. 5. Параметр "Включить логирование" позволяет включить или ... Читать далее

Не меняется статус заказа после переезда на sberbank.ecom2?

Если после переезда на sberbank.ecom2 не меняется статус заказа в системе 1C-Bitrix, то возможны несколько причин и решений: 1. Проверьте настройки интеграции с системой sberbank.ecom2. Убедитесь, что вы правильно настроили связь с платежной системой и указали все необходимые параметры. Проверьте наличие и правильность указания параметров, таких как «Merchant Login» и «Merchant Password». Эти параметры нужны ... Читать далее

Как при импорте инфоблока в Детальное описание поместить html?

Для того чтобы при импорте инфоблока в Детальное описание поместить HTML, вам понадобится использовать пользовательское свойство типа "HTML/текст". Процесс состоит из трех основных этапов: создание свойства, настройка импорта и активация обработки HTML. 1. Создание свойства типа "HTML/текст": - Перейдите на страницу управления инфоблоками в административной панели 1C-Bitrix. - Выберите нужный инфоблок и перейдите на вкладку ... Читать далее